As Women’s Fund Manager at the CFMT, Janyl Igadna manages and stewards the growth of the Women’s Fund, an initiative dedicated to supporting women and girls across the region. She leads the planning and coordination of events that bring donors and advocates together, raising critical support through community engagement, networking, and storytelling.

Prior to joining CFMT, Janyl served in corporate relations roles at the Tennessee Performing Arts Center and Thistle Farms, where she built strategic partnerships to strengthen support for the arts and anti-human trafficking efforts in Nashville.


“I was drawn to CFMT because of its deep, lasting impact on the community,” says Janyl. “The Foundation’s collaborative spirit and wide-reaching support of local causes align with my passion for connecting people to meaningful work.”


Outside of work, Janyl is always on the move—whether she’s Olympic weightlifting, hiking, traveling, or trying new restaurants. She loves experiencing new cultures, especially through food, and is always up for an adventure.
